The State Department for Economic planning under the National Treasury has announced 244 vacancies for the positions of Economist/Statistician, (CSG 8, Job Group N).
In a public notice dated July 22, 2025 the State department invited applicants to fill in the positions of Senior Economist/ Statistician at the State Department for Economic Planning.
“The State Department for Economic Planning invites applicants from qualified persons for the position of Senior Economic/Statistician, CSG, B,” the notice read.
The positions are under permanent and pensionable terms.
To apply , candidates must have served in the grade of Economist/ Statistician I for a minimum period of three (3) years.
The department requires a Bachelors degree in Economics, Statistics, Mathematics, Finance, Economics, or any equivalent qualification from a recognized institution.
Membership to a relevant professional body required.
A certificate in computer application from a recognized institution is also required.
According to the State department qualified candidates will receive a basic salary of Ksh52,330 to Ksh 96,130, house allowance of Ksh35,000, commuter allowance of Ksh 8000 per month, and annual leave allowance, 6000 per year.
Successful candidates will be responsible for preparing Sectoral briefs, reviews and reports, initiate the preparation of annual, mid term, and end term progress reports, undertaking economic modelling and forecasting among others.
How to apply:
Interested candidates are requested to make their applications by filling Employment Form PSC 2 (Revised 2016). The form can be downloaded from the Public Service Commission of Kenya website.
Candidates are encouraged to apply before 5 p.m. on July 30, 2025.
They are advised to submit the application form via email to the department, or by hand delivery at the Treasury Building, or by postal mail address, [email protected].
